Stayed at Leo Bay camp site for 4 nights , the owner Steve couldn't do enough to ensure my stay was perfect, it was my first time staying in my micro camper and I was not properly prepared but Steve came to the rescue with tarpaulin and magnets to use as a make shift awning , he offered lots of good advice i was made to feel very welcome and most comfortable, not only are the pitches HUGE they each have a pea shingle hard standing PLUS a large grass area with picnic table , 2 EHU , beautiful shrubs and a hedge to separate from the next pitch , gorgeous river views , site was spotless , beautiful grounds , you could hear the bird song all day , butterfly's everywhere, and an added bonus of a huge summer house with a microwave, cooker , sink , cutlery crockery , large corner leather sofa , table and chairs even a snooker table , also toilet and showers built into a static caravan , much better than a cold concrete shower block , highly recommended will definitely visit again

Don't be put off by the pot-holed access road, it will be worth it. This is a little gem of a site. Overlooking Queenborough harbour. A bit quirky but it really works. Check out the gardens and reception area, we were there quite a while and always found something different. Owner Steve very friendly and helpful. Also does motor home repairs and conversions. His right hand man Charlie is always on hand if any problems. Although facilities are basic, they are more than adequate and always clean. Excellent dog walks just off site. Would certainly recommend this site.
